Grilled BBQ Chicken Recipe For Juicy Bites Every Time

After about ten minutes on the grill, this Grilled BBQ Chicken Recipe starts to give off that smoky aroma that makes everyone hang around outside. The meat gets a perfect char while staying juicy on the inside, and every bite picks up the flavor of the sauce you brush on. It’s simple enough for a weeknight cookout but turns out like something from a summer barbecue spot.
You can make it with boneless or bone-in chicken, but the trick is slow heat and layering the barbecue sauce near the end so it thickens just right without burning.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ings: 4
Course: BBQ, Dinner, Main Course, Main Dish
Cuisine: American
Calories: 320

Ingredients
  

  • 4 chicken breasts or thighs boneless or bone-in
  • 1 cup barbecue sauce homemade or your favorite brand
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• ½ TSP garlic powder
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 1 TBSP lemon juice

Method
 

  1. Pat the chicken dry with a paper towel and place it in a large bowl.
  2. Add olive oil, paprika, garlic powder, pepper, salt, and lemon juice. Toss to coat everything evenly.
  3. Preheat your grill to medium heat. Clean and lightly oil the grates.
  4. Grill the chicken for 5–6 minutes per side if boneless, or 7–8 minutes for bone-in.
  5. Start brushing barbecue sauce during the last few minutes of grilling, flipping once so both sides get coated.
  6. Cook until the internal temperature hits 75°C (165°F).
  7.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before serving so the juices stay inside.

Notes

  • Use a meat thermometer to avoid overcooking chicken, and it dries out fast once it passes 165°F.
  • If you’re using bone-in chicken, cook it on indirect heat first, then sear it over direct heat at the end.
  • You can use spicy, smoky, or honey BBQ sauce depending on what you like.

Tips & Tricks

  • Always oil the grill grates before placing the chicken. It helps keep the skin from sticking.
  • For the best grilled BBQ chicken flavor, brush the sauce in thin layers instead of dumping it all at once.
  • Marinate for at least an hour if you have time; it gives the chicken a deep smoky kick.
  • Keep an extra small bowl of clean sauce for serving (never reuse the one used for brushing).
